The
Official Transformers Collector's Club has
announced that two of the three Dobson Brothers have been added to the BotCon guest list.
Michael Dobson, best known for his performance as Starscream in Armada, Energon and Cybertron, will be joined by his brother Brain Dobson, who has voiced Red Alert in Armada and Cybertron.
No word has been given if Paul Dobson, the third of the brothers and known as the voices for Sideways in Armada, Rodimus in Energon and Landmine in Cybertron, will be planning on joining the party.
Previously, Wally Burr (G1 director) and Michael Chain (G1 Powerglide, Hoist and Red Alert) were already announces as special guests for BotCon 2005.

The official
BotCon website has been updated.
Announcing the first two of their celebrity guests: Wally Burr and Michael Chain.
Wally Burr was the voice director of all 98 episodes of Transformers as well as a whole host of other cartoon shows from the 80's. Michael Chain is best known for being the voice for characters like Hoist, Powerglide and Red Alert in the original series. Other than Transformers, Chain basically left voice acting for what it was, with the exception of voice overs in commercials and television and pursued a career in (country) music.

The latest member of the Botcon Exclusive 7-pack has been revealed. It is Deathsaurus (aka Dezsaras), a redeco of RID Megatron. The toy will have an all-new head resembling Dezsaras, the main villain from Transformers Victory. He will also sport a slightly modified color scheme.

Botcon Updates with costume contest details. Nice to see that they will actually be giving out prizes for the creative folks who cosplay and add that interesting element to the convention.
08/03 -
BotCon '05 UPDATE! All attendees are invited to come to the
convention dressed as their favorite TRANSFORMERS characters -- Optimus Prime,
Megatron, etc. as part of a special “Transformers: More Than Meets The Eyeâ€
costume contest on Saturday morning. Fans should come dressed in their best, most
authentic Transformers costume for a chance to win cool prizes and Transformers toys.
First prize is worth $600 ($300 in show dollars that you can spend at the convention and a $300
gift certificate to Hasbro’s online store,
hasbrotoyshop.com); second prize, $300 ($150 show
dollars, $150 gift certificate); and third prize, $150 ($75 show dollars, $75 gift certificate).
